Abstract

In this paper, mass sweeping efficiency factor (fm) and current efficiency factor (fi) have been computed for Z-pinch devices. We used slug model for analysis of Z-pinch dynamics. Magnetic piston reaps electrons and ions in duration of motion. But only a fraction of plasma mass sweeps with magnetic piston, therefore we should add mass sweeping efficiency factor (fm) in equations. Such like alone the fraction of electrical current flows of magnetic piston and remainder of it flows of internal and external radial of magnetic piston, so we should add fi in equations. In this paper, equations are solved with characteristics of CERN Z-pinch device (its length and radius, resistivity, circuit inductance and capacitanc and plasma inductance) and with values of Boggasch experiments (discharge voltage: 15 kV, initial pressure: 400 pa). Recorded code runs with different values of fm and fi and in each section, pinch time and pinch current are compared with Boggasch experimental values. Optimum values for fm and fi obtain with Comparing between numerical values and experimental values. These values are fi = 0.8 and fm = 0.08.
